For Ganeski - You have to pull the file from the dayz code which is linked to you in the mission.sqm. Basically pull that one and edit it to the first post and you should be good to go..
As for vikingr you have a simple problem here..
#waittoactivate
~300
goto "nighttest"
Just replace the goto "nighttest" line with goto "nighttest"
This is basically your problem because it has forum color codes in it because it is red..
(this is the line non red - goto "[B.][COLOR..=#ff0000]nighttest[/..COLOR][/..B]" )
it should be
goto "nighttest"
Its a mistake many make because in that post he is showing you where to put it, just gotta watch out, basically remove that and you should be good to go! Let me know if this works for you and post back if you need any further help
